This issue has been a hotbed of discussion between myself and some other scripters I know, but I've never seen any real discussion or explaination. Does anyone know why when you run a timer and send a linked message from the timer event, everything in world "jumps"? You can sometimes see this too with vendors, when you click them to use them, they will suddenly shift position, as the link messages kick off. And for the first time tonight, with the latest viewer, (1.14.0) I noticed if I was editing a prim's contents while wearing something with a link message timer going, the inventory listing of the prim would also jump in time with the link message (it was a seperate prim I was editing, not the one sending link messages).

Why would link messages cause things in world to jump or move? And is there any trick to prevent or mitigate this, besides "don't use a link message"?
